A: POM (Acetal) offers superior dimensional stability and lower moisture absorption compared to Nylon. In Hamburg’s humid coastal climate, POM ensures that gear teeth do not swell, maintaining precise tolerances in critical medical or optical devices.
A: Yes, by using fiber-reinforced polymers and optimized tooth geometries, our plastic gears are used in applications requiring significant torque, while offering the added benefit of vibration damping and noise reduction compared to steel.
